Strange. It's working great here (except for the display bug of course, but from S4 pressing Fn+F8 does get me my text console back). I have the suspend to disk as the first primary partition, of a size 2 * memory + 64 mb or so (to accomodate for video memory and suspend restore program). I'd rather have a working S3 though, it takes about 2 minutes to write the whole of ram to the s2d partition, so its much faster to just shutdown.
